Color Visualization of 2D Segmentations

Christoph Dalitz, Tobias Bolten, Oliver Christen



This paper deals with the problem of coloring a two-dimensional segmentation result in such a way that each segment has a different color with the constraint that adjacent segments have sufficiently distinct colors to be easily distinguishable by a human viewer. Our solution for this problem is based on a balanced coloring of the neighborhood graph built from the area Voronoi diagram. The balanced coloring with only a limited number of colors is subsequently modified to assign each segment a unique color. For picking the initial palette of evenly distributed colors, we propose a method that is based on the physical analogy of energy minimization in a Wigner crystal. To make the energy formula applicable to arbitrary color spaces and distance measures, we give generalized definitions for the center and radius of a color space with an arbitrary distance metric. The individual steps of our coloring algorithm have been evaluated on the PRIMA dataset.


  1. Antonacopoulos, A., Bridson, D., Papadopoulos, C., and Pletschacher, S. (2009). A realistic dataset for performance evaluation of document layout analysis. In International Conference on Document Analysis and Recognition (ICDAR), pages 296-300.
  2. Arcelli, C. and di Baja, G. S. (1986). Computing voronoi diagrams in digital pictures. Pattern Recognition Letters, 4:383-389.
  3. Deutsches Institut für Normung (2001). Farbmetrische Bestimmung von Farbabständen bei Körperfarben nach der DIN99-Formel. DIN 6176.
  4. Devillers, O. (2002). The delaunay hierarchy. International Journal of Foundations of Computer Science, 13:163- 180.
  5. Ikonomakis, N. and Plataniotis, K. (1999). A region-based color image segmentation scheme. In Visual Communications and Image Processing (VCIP), pages 1201- 1209.
  6. K. Kise, A. Sato, M. I. (1998). Segmentation of page images using the area voronoi diagram. Computer Vision and Image Understanding, 70:370-382.
  7. Lu, Y. and Tan, C. (2005). Constructing area voronoi diagram in document images. In International Conference on Document Analysis and Recognition (ICDAR), pages 342-346.
  8. Matula, D., Shiloach, Y., and Tarjan, R. (1980). Two lineartime algorithms for five-coloring a planar graph. Technical Report STAN-CS-80-830, Stanford University.
  9. Mojsilovic, A. and Soljanin, E. (2001). Color quantization and processing by fibonacci lattices. IEEE Transactions on Image Processing, 10:1712-1725.
  10. Pemmaraju, S., Nakprasit, K., and Kostochka, A. (2003). Equitable colorings with constant number of colors. In ACM-SIAM Symposium on Discrete Algorithms (SODA), pages 458-459.
  11. Rafac, R., Schiffer, J., Hangst, J., Dubin, D., and Wales, D. (1991). Stable configurations of confined cold ionic systems. Proc. Ntl. Acad. Sci. USA, 88:483-486.
  12. Sarifuddin, M. and Missaoui, R. (2005). A new perceptually uniform color space with associated color similarity measure for content-based image and video retrieval. In ACM SIGIR Workshop on Multimedia Information Retrieval, pages 1-8.
  13. Saund, E., Ling, J., and Sarkar, P. (2009). Pixlabeler: User interface for pixel-level labeling of elements in document images. In International Conference on Document Analysis and Recognition (ICDAR), pages 646- 650.
  14. Shafait, F., Keysers, D., and Breuel, T. (2006). Pixelaccurate representation and evaluation of page segmentation in document images. In International Conference on Pattern Recognition (ICPR), pages 872- 875.

Paper Citation

in Harvard Style

Dalitz C., Bolten T. and Christen O. (2013). Color Visualization of 2D Segmentations . In Proceedings of the International Conference on Computer Graphics Theory and Applications and International Conference on Information Visualization Theory and Applications - Volume 1: IVAPP, (VISIGRAPP 2013) ISBN 978-989-8565-46-4, pages 567-572. DOI: 10.5220/0004184905670572

in Bibtex Style

author={Christoph Dalitz and Tobias Bolten and Oliver Christen},
title={Color Visualization of 2D Segmentations},
booktitle={Proceedings of the International Conference on Computer Graphics Theory and Applications and International Conference on Information Visualization Theory and Applications - Volume 1: IVAPP, (VISIGRAPP 2013)},

in EndNote Style

JO - Proceedings of the International Conference on Computer Graphics Theory and Applications and International Conference on Information Visualization Theory and Applications - Volume 1: IVAPP, (VISIGRAPP 2013)
TI - Color Visualization of 2D Segmentations
SN - 978-989-8565-46-4
AU - Dalitz C.
AU - Bolten T.
AU - Christen O.
PY - 2013
SP - 567
EP - 572
DO - 10.5220/0004184905670572